Keolis appoints Paul D’Alessio as Valley Metro Operations GM and Vice President

Feb 21, 2025

A seasoned leader in rail operations, D’Alessio brings a wealth of global experience to support Valley Metro’s continued growth and commitment to excellence

Keolis North America (Keolis) today announced that Paul D’Alessio has joined the company as vice president and general manager of Keolis’ Valley Metro operations in the East Valley (Tempe and Mesa). D’Alessio brings more than 30 years of leadership experience in global transportation, including light rail, fixed-route, metropolitan rail, regional intercity rail, bus, and aviation operations. He will report directly to the chief operating officer of Keolis’ U.S. transit business and play a key role in advancing operational performance, employee engagement, and passenger experience in Tempe and Mesa.

D’Alessio joins Keolis from Yarra Trams in Melbourne, Australia, where he served as chief operating officer, leading service delivery and passenger experience for the world’s largest tram network. His tenure was marked by exceptional results, including record-setting driver recruitment and training efforts, operational improvements, and safety initiatives. Under his leadership, Yarra Trams operations achieved key performance indicators, improved employee engagement, and delivered the highest customer satisfaction rating among all transport operators, as measured by the public transport authority.
